Hi, Bob Fields. I just today bought a 2009 Cherokee Park Model and can't get the Concertone stereo to power up. Just new to this site and don't know my way around yet. Is there a trouble shooting guide on here, I could use. I have not notified the dealer yet. I pulled the fuse and changed it, did nothing. I will try removing the batteries from the remote tomorrow. Thanks for any help, you can give me. NorminN.B.

Normin, try cutting all power to the unit. ie pull fuse and turn braker off.. do Both and then turn back on, should work ( like rebootin your puter) I have to do this once in a while on mine also, I have a 07 Sandpiper 5th wheel

Thanks for the update - I understand these issues can be frustrating!

This is why many have recommending checking all the wiring connections no matter what the issue to ensure you are starting from a point where at least you know the wires are hooked up right.

As a reminder, the wiring diagram in on a label on the back of every unit.
